Ingress protection ratings is the rank of protection offered by an enclosure, against dust and water. The letters 'IP' are followed by two values The first value of the IP rating represents protection against solids such as dust, followed by the one that refers to protection against liquids (water).

Having a value of IPX7, the Raycon Fitness Earbuds's rating for solids indicates that no data available to specify a protection rating, and the second value of 7 means that they are protected against temporary immersion in water under set conditions, say 1 metre for 30 minutes. In comparison to the Raycon Fitness Earbuds, Marshall Minor III have a rating of IPX4 meaning that we are not yet certain of their rating with solids (dust) and that of liquids is that, Marshall Minor III has a lower liquid rating than Raycon Fitness Earbuds The Raycon Fitness Earbuds have a weight of 141.75g . The Marshall Minor III also have stereo speakers ANC makes use of advanced technology to reduce ambient sounds.

How it works, it detects and analyzes the sound pattern outside and inside the earbud and after inverts the soundwaves to counter it. Simply put, it's like taking +1 (sound from your surrounding) then adding -1 (counter sound by the device) to make zero thus "diluting" the noise.

The Raycon Fitness Earbuds have Active Noise Cancellation allowing you to listen at lower volume levels, causing less ear fatigue since you don't have to crank up the device volume to outcompete background noise.

The Raycon Fitness Earbuds have a unit size of 8mm in diameter, bigger drivers are more powerful, and can produce better bass. A driver unit is the component that makes sound in the device, its size corellates with the sound made by the earbuds.

Marshall Minor III driver unit is 12mm in diameter, making them have a larger driver unit than that of Raycon Fitness Earbuds by 4mm , as many tend to believe that driver units of a bigger size automatically produce better sound quality.

However, large drivers find it difficult to produce high frequencies so yes, larger drivers are capable of generating louder sound, but this does not indicate that they produce better quality sound.
